Star Fork
Star Fork is a stream in Ritchie, West Virginia. Star Fork is situated nearby to the village Pullman, as well as near the hamlet Five Forks.Places in the Area

Pullman
Village
Pullman is a town in Ritchie County, West Virginia, United States. The population was 134 at the 2020 census. Pullman was platted in 1883, and named after George Pullman, a businessperson in the rail industry.
